Father, we come before You as a body of believers, united in the name of Jesus, asking that You indeed save, protect, and heal all who call upon Your name. Your Word declares in Psalm 91:14-16, "Because he has set his love on me, therefore I will deliver him. I will set him on high, because he has known my name. He will call on me, and I will answer him. I will be with him in trouble. I will deliver him and honor him. I will satisfy him with long life, and show him my salvation." Lord, we claim this promise over every life represented here, trusting that You are our refuge and fortress in times of trouble.
We pray that You would cultivate in us a love for You that consumes our whole hearts, souls, and minds, just as Your greatest commandment instructs in Matthew 22:37-38, "You shall love the Lord your God with all your heart, with all your soul, and with all your mind. This is the first and great commandment." Father, strip away anything in our lives that competes for Your affection—whether it be idols of this world, sinful habits, or distractions that pull us away from wholehearted devotion to You. Create in us clean hearts, O God, and renew a right spirit within us (Psalm 51:10).
We also stand firm against the schemes of the enemy, who seeks to steal, kill, and destroy (John 10:10). In the name of Jesus, we rebuke every spirit of fear, sickness, division, and oppression that may be at work in our lives or the lives of those we pray for. Your Word assures us in James 4:7, "Be subject therefore to God. Resist the devil, and he will flee from you." We take authority over the enemy, declaring that he has no power over us, for we are covered by the blood of Jesus and sealed by the Holy Spirit.
Lord, we thank You for the victory we have in Christ and for the healing that is already ours through His stripes (Isaiah 53:5). We trust in Your perfect will, whether that healing comes in this life or the next, and we ask for the faith to believe that You are working all things together for our good (Romans 8:28). Strengthen us to walk in obedience, holiness, and love, reflecting Your light in a dark world.
Father, we are grateful for the privilege of coming before You in the name of Jesus, for there is no other name under heaven by which we can be saved (Acts 4:12). We acknowledge that apart from Christ, we can do nothing (John 15:5), and we humbly submit ourselves to Your lordship. For those who may not yet know Jesus as their Lord and Savior, we pray that You would draw them to Yourself, open their eyes to the truth of the Gospel, and grant them the gift of repentance and faith. May they confess with their mouths that Jesus is Lord and believe in their hearts that God raised Him from the dead, so that they may be saved (Romans 10:9-10).
In closing, we declare that our hope is anchored in You, Lord, and we trust in Your unfailing love and mercy. May Your will be done in our lives, and may we bring glory to Your name in all that we do. We pray all these things in the mighty and matchless name of Jesus Christ, our Savior and King. Amen.
